What is the Exness Investor Account?
The Exness Investor Account allows clients to provide other traders or investment managers with access to their accounts. This account type is particularly advantageous for individuals who may lack the time or expertise to trade actively in the financial markets. Instead of managing trades themselves, account owners can entrust their funds to experienced professionals whose strategy they believe in.

How Does the Exness Investor Account Work?
To use the Exness Investor Account, clients must follow a straightforward process:

- Account Setup: Clients must create an account with Exness and choose the Investor Account option.
- Select a Trader: Once the account is set up, clients can browse a selection of traders available on the platform. Each trader typically has their performance data, helping investors decide who to trust with their funds.
- Investment Allocation: Clients can allocate a portion of their funds to the selected trader, who will then make trades on the client’s behalf.
- Monitoring Performance: Investors can monitor their account and the performance of their chosen traders through the Exness trading platform.

Considerations Before Opening an Investor Account
While the Exness Investor Account has many benefits, there are certain considerations to keep in mind:
- Risk Management: Even when investing through skilled traders, there are inherent risks. It’s crucial to assess the risk tolerance and understand that past performance is not always indicative of future results.
- Fees and Charges: Be aware of any fees associated with using the investor account, as these can affect overall profitability.
- Screener Tools: Investors must use the available tools to research and evaluate potential traders effectively.
